Who is yoga suitable for?

Yoga is suitable for everyone - all ages and abilities, but please contact Tessa in advance if you have an injury or a medical condition from the list below. It doesn't necessarily mean you can't attend a class but certain postures may need to be modified.

If you are (or think you could be) pregnant or have a serious condition a general class may not be suitable - again please contact Tessa to discuss.

  • Hypertension (high blood pressure)
  • Heart disease (angina)
  • Heart attack
  • Epilepsy (minor/major)
  • Diabetes
  • Cancer
  • Detached retina
  • Menière's disease
  • Multiple sclerosis
  • ME (Myalgic Encephalomyelitis)
  • HIV / AIDS
  • Asthma
  • Allergies
  • Varicose veins
  • Nose bleeds
  • Have you had a baby in the last 12 months?
  • Knee problems
  • Back problems
  • Neck or shoulder problems
  • Hip problems
  • Ankle problems
